This article relates to a pedestal that detects the direction in which a person passes and impacts from the outside even when a decorative object such as a doll is placed on it, and generates multiple types of sounds in response to the detection results. (Prior Art) In recent years, stuffed animals with built-in sensors and sound generators that detect specific shocks and light have been put on the market. Therefore, when trying to make a wide variety of stuffed animals with different appearances having the above configuration, each stuffed animal must be equipped with a sensor and a sound generating device, making the cost of one stuffed animal extremely high. It was something. In addition, a stuffed animal toy with a certain appearance was designed to perform only certain sensing and sound generation operations, so it was not interesting once the user got used to it. In addition, the view of toys has recently been reconsidered. In other words, conventional toys move by winding up a spring or turning on a switch, and even dolls that do not have springs or switches have meaning only when children empathize with them. Without their active efforts, it would have been nothing more than a mere object. (Purpose of the Invention) The inventors of the present invention were established in view of the above-mentioned problems, and even if they are ordinary stuffed animals, dolls, or other decorations, they are sensitive to the loads caused by people passing by, impacts given by people, etc. and operate,
The technical challenge is to provide a pedestal that allows for a more positive emotional interaction that could not be achieved with conventional toys. (Means for Solving the Problems) In order to achieve the above object, a pedestal according to the present invention includes a mounting section for removably mounting a plurality of types of decorations, and a mounting section for detecting external stimuli. The present invention is characterized by comprising: a detection means; and a change means for generating sound, light, movement, etc. in accordance with the detection result of the detection means. (Function) According to the present invention, the pedestal itself has means for detecting and changing external stimuli such as light, sound, and impact, so if a decoration such as a stuffed toy is placed on the pedestal, the stuffed toy, etc. Even if a decorative object does not have anything built-in, the decorative object has the function of detecting light, impact, etc. from the outside and generating changes in sound, light, vibration, etc. using a changing means in response to it. Can be done. Therefore, by simply providing the above-mentioned detection means and change means only on the pedestal, a wide variety of decorations can be used. (Example) Fig. 1 shows a perspective view of a pedestal in which the present invention is implemented. This pedestal 1 has a base 5 equipped with a placing part 3, and as shown in FIG. 2, decorations 7 such as stuffed animals and dolls are placed on the placing part 3 in a replaceable manner. .. A raised edge 9 is formed on the upper edge of the base 5, and the front surface 1
In order to detect the passing direction of a person passing in front of the front surface l1, two left and right detection optical sensors 13 and l5 are provided at horizontally distant positions, and is provided with an impact sensor 17 for detecting an impact applied to the decoration 7 placed on the placement section 3. Inside the pedestal 1, a sound generating device 19 (changing means) is provided which generates a plurality of types of sounds according to the detection results of the left and right detection optical sensors 13 and 15 and the impact sensor 17. The main switch 17a of the sound generating device 19 is provided on the placing section 3, and is configured to be turned on automatically when the ornament 7 is placed. Next, the above-mentioned internal device will be explained with reference to FIG. That is, the light detection signals from the left and right detection optical sensors 13 and 15 are input into the interior of the pedestal l, and the light detection signals from the left and right detection optical sensors 13 and l5 are input to
A left/right direction detection circuit 21 outputs a signal (R signal, L signal) indicating the passing direction of the person (object) passing in front of 1, ie, right direction 18 or left direction 20, and An impact level detection circuit 23 that inputs a signal according to the level and outputs two types of signals (H signal, L signal) depending on the level of the impact, the left and right direction detection circuit 2l and the impact level detection circuit A sound generating device 19 for generating four types of sounds according to signals from 23 is provided. In this embodiment, when a person passes the front surface 1) of the pedestal in the right direction l8, that is, when the R signal is supplied from the left-right direction detection circuit 2l, If a person passes in the left direction 20, that is, if an L signal is supplied from the left and right detection circuit 2l, a voice saying "Welcome" is generated, When a strong impact is applied to the decoration 7, that is, when an H signal is supplied from the impact level detection circuit 23, a voice saying "I want to go" is generated, and a weak impact is applied to the decoration 7. When the shock level is applied, that is, when the L signal is supplied from the shock level detection circuit 23, the system is configured to generate the sound "Konnichiwa". That is, as shown in FIG. 4, the sound generating device 19 receives signals from the left-right direction detection circuit 21i3 and the impact level detection circuit 23, and outputs the above-mentioned types of sound signals. The dedicated IC circuit 25 and the above I
It consists of an audio amplifier section 27 for amplifying the audio signal from the C circuit 25, and a slot 29 for converting the signal amplified by the audio amplifier section 27 into sound. Further, specific circuit examples of the left-right direction detection circuit 2l and the impact level detection circuit 23 are shown in FIGS. 5 and 6, respectively.
Although shown in the figure, the detection circuits 2l and 23 are not limited to the specific example described above, and various configurations are possible. Next, how to use the pedestal 1 will be explained. First, the above-mentioned pedestal l is installed in a corner of the store entrance, etc., so that the direction in which people enter the store is the above-mentioned right direction, and the opposite direction is the left direction. Then, a decoration 7 such as a stuffed toy that matches the atmosphere of the store is placed on the placing portion 3 of the installed pedestal l. Then, each time a customer enters or exits the doorway, the stuffed animal mentioned above will greet the customer. Additionally, if a customer touches the stuffed animal and applies a shock to it, it will react to the shock. Furthermore, the decorations 7 can be freely replaced to suit the atmosphere of the store. Furthermore, in the above embodiment, the left-right direction detection means and the impact level detection means were provided together on one pedestal, but it goes without saying that they can be provided on separate pedestals. In addition, the pedestal changing means may be configured to vibrate the placing part 3 in response to detection by the sensor, thereby making the ornaments on the placing part 3 dance. In this case, the raised edge 9 prevents the decoration from falling off the base 5. (Effects of the Invention) As described above, according to the present invention, the system senses people's comings and goings, shocks, etc., and responds with sounds, lights, movements, etc., and changes. You will be able to have more positive emotional contact with others than you would have been able to do otherwise. Additionally, multiple types of stuffed animals, dolls, and other decorations can be freely replaced to suit the surrounding atmosphere.
